IntroductionAlthough you have ample time to choose your path, the sooner you can figure out what you want to concentrate in, the better. You give yourself more time to explore other interests withouth running into time constraints to complete your requirements. Enjoy your free time, but even when you just have to study the libraries have a social feeling as well. If you like to go out to clubs or parties 5 nights a week and sleep all day don't go to Brown. If you can find a balance between social and academic, go for it. Enjoy Brown; I did.
Campus Life and Social LifeThe social life is decent, especially if you don't limit yourself to a certain group or "type" of friends. Explore! Get to know all kinds of people. Sports teams are hard working and competitive, however student support is below par. Get out and support sports teams and make a party out of it! Tons of clubs to join...get out there and get involved.
AcademicsEach of the departments are interesting and unique. Brown is a great chance to get a well-rounded education from top faculty and lots of opportunities to learn from your peers.
Student BodyThe student body is probably one of the most diverse in the nation.
In Closing...Explore the city of Providence. One of the best mid-sized college towns on the east coast.
